From d09e10f6991b2feec7bac08d1fb58d514ae8f52f Mon Sep 17 00:00:00 2001 From: Hannes Heine Date: Mon, 9 Aug 2021 16:38:40 +0200 Subject: [PATCH] WIP Register. --- frontend/src/views/Pages/Register.spec.js | 2 +- frontend/src/views/Pages/Register.vue | 16 ++++++---------- frontend/src/views/Pages/ResetPassword.spec.js | 5 +++++ 3 files changed, 12 insertions(+), 11 deletions(-) diff --git a/frontend/src/views/Pages/Register.spec.js b/frontend/src/views/Pages/Register.spec.js index b200eb397..0b41bf014 100644 --- a/frontend/src/views/Pages/Register.spec.js +++ b/frontend/src/views/Pages/Register.spec.js @@ -105,6 +105,6 @@ describe('Register', () => { }) }) - // To Do: Test lines 156-197,210-213 + // To Do: Test lines 160-205,218 }) }) diff --git a/frontend/src/views/Pages/Register.vue b/frontend/src/views/Pages/Register.vue index 570bd83db..f4f18ce52 100755 --- a/frontend/src/views/Pages/Register.vue +++ b/frontend/src/views/Pages/Register.vue @@ -183,17 +183,13 @@ export default { password: this.form.password.password, }, }) - .then((result) => { - if (result.success) { - this.form.email = '' - this.form.firstname = '' - this.form.lastname = '' - this.form.password.password = '' + .then(() => { + this.form.email = '' + this.form.firstname = '' + this.form.lastname = '' + this.form.password.password = '' - this.$router.push('/thx/register') - } else { - throw new Error(result.errors[0].message) - } + this.$router.push('/thx/register') }) .catch((error) => { this.showError = true diff --git a/frontend/src/views/Pages/ResetPassword.spec.js b/frontend/src/views/Pages/ResetPassword.spec.js index 4595314fa..5660866a1 100644 --- a/frontend/src/views/Pages/ResetPassword.spec.js +++ b/frontend/src/views/Pages/ResetPassword.spec.js @@ -86,6 +86,11 @@ describe('ResetPassword', () => { }) }) + it('Has sessionId from API call', async () => { + await wrapper.vm.$nextTick() + expect(wrapper.vm.sessionId).toBe(1) + }) + it('renders the Reset Password form when authenticated', () => { expect(wrapper.find('div.resetpwd-form').exists()).toBeTruthy() })